Labradorite and Diamond Brooch, Sterlé, 1960s
Labradorite and Diamond Brooch, Sterlé, 1960s. Photo Sotheby's
Designed as a stylised bird in flight, the body set with carved labradorite, the wings set with textured yellow gold, single-, circular-, and brilliant-cut diamonds, the tail of yellow gold fringes, cheveu d'ange, mounted in yellow gold and platinum, unsigned, French assay and maker's marks. Estimate: 11,000 - 14,000 CHF - LOT SOLD. 30,000 CHF
LITERATURE: Cf: Viviane Jutheau, Sterlé Joaillier Paris, Paris, 1990, for further examples of bird brooches by Sterlé.
